Definition of setup fee - Reverso English Dictionary
Noun
1.
initial chargeinitial cost for configuring equipment or software
- There is a setup fee for installing the new software.
2.
telecommunicationsone-time payment for establishing a service
- There is a setup fee for installing the internet service.
